Death Penalty Measure To Be Discussed at Culver-Palms

 

October 10, 2012



Culver-Palms United Methodist Church will present a program on Proposition 34 at noon on Sunday, October 14. Learn about how the proposition seeks to replace California’s death penalty with life without possibility of parole.

James Clark, an advocate for the “Yes on 34”campaign will present reasons for favoring the proposition. A light lunch will be provided, and all are invited whether they are for or against the proposition, or simply want to learn more about it.
